513 Brigade Continues its Support to Female Cricketer by Erecting New Home

The Security Force HQ-Jaffna, in an attempt to further inspire the growth of sports talents of the teenager, Christiga Selvarasa of Chulipuram Victoria College in Jaffna who has now been selected to the under-19 female cricket team of Sri Lanka, has offered its manpower, technical and engineering skills for construction of a new house to her family in collaboration with Nallur-based Thiyahie Charitable Trust (TCT).

16 Gemunu Watch troops of the 513 Brigade of the 51 Division have undertaken the project to erect the new home as an appreciative gesture of her achievements as a school-aged female cricketer on the directions given by Major General K.A.A Udaya Kumara, General Officer Commanding, 51 Division and Colonel M Rizvi Razick, 513 Brigade Commander with the blessings of Major General Chandana Wijayasundera, Commander, Security Forces -Jaffna.

The overseas-based TCT Chairman, Mr Vamadevan Thiyagendran (Thiyahie) who has been an ardent supporter of the community-oriented projects of the Army, in an impressive gesture of goodwill and understanding, provided financial incentives for construction of the new house to this girl who brought fame. It was the 513 Brigade Commander, Colonel Rizvi Razick with the blessings of Major General Udaya Kumara, General Officer Commanding (GOC) of the 51 Division and the Commander, Security Forces-Jaffna a few months back, took the initiative of finding a sponsor to help her proceed with sustained cricket training with a monthly allocation of Rs 5000/= by way of a scholarship, given by an overseas-based donor because of her economic hardships.

On Friday (16), the General Officer Commanding 51 Division, together with the sponsor and 513 Brigade Commander laid foundation stones for erection of the home in Chullipurama, amidst Hindu religious blessings and traditions. After the foundation-laying ceremony, the General Officer Commanding 51 Division provided a cash donation to the deserving family of the budding sports star.
